I think that corns are no longer classified as rat snakes. Rat snakes are in the genius Elaphe, while corns are in the genius Pantherophis. They all used to be in Elaphe, but there are profound differences between the two and they finally were reclassified- quite a few years ago! It hasn't caught on yet though!

All North American rats including corns are Pantherophis. Elaphe is used for the other rat snakes other than in North America. The crazy russians keep changing the taxonomy.
